6.5x284 is the cartridge to beat at 1K yards for a target shooter, at least in prone competition. It's a barrel burning SOB that has nothing on any decent hunting cartridge at 500 yards and under.
The brass is expensive and my barrels were replaced in less than 1000 rounds and usually at 800. When and if I ever get to competing again, I'll go with the 30 cal.
